Pseudodifferential Analysis, Automorphic Distributions in the Plane and Modular Forms
Pseudodifferential analysis, introduced in this book in a way adapted to the needs of number theorists, relates automorphic function theory in the hyperbolic half-plane Π to automorphic distribution theory in the plane.
